The globalist design for micro-apartments is being championed by New
York’s Mayor Michael Bloomberg. These “studio and one-bedroom apartments” will
be no bigger than 275 to 300 sq ft. These
tiny
living spaces are smaller than currently allowed by building regulations,
according to a
statement
by Bloomberg’s office; however the zoning regulations will be waived in over
to construct the first of many compact pack ‘em and stack ‘em housing model in
the city-owned area of Kips Bay.
